Our purpose is to guide all companies toward a sustainable world. EcoVadis is the leading provider of business sustainability ratings. Our solutions are backed by an international team of experts and powerful technology. We analyze data and build sustainability scorecards that give companies actionable insights into their environmental, social and ethical risks.
